Roman mosaic, with a fish design. Mosaics are artworks consisting of small pieces of colored glass, stone, or other materials, placed together to form a geometric pattern or image, on a floor or wall. Images of fishes are frequently found in Roman mosaics and may have religious symbolism. This mosaic is located in the gardens of the Alcazar, the royal castle and palace in Cordoba, Spain. Roman rule in Cordoba dates to the first century BC, though the Alcazar as it now exists was not built until many centuries later
